Pokémon Go’s first big sponsored promotion could launch later this week at Starbucks, based on images shared across Reddit. Several users have uploaded screenshots of special Starbucks iconography appearing in the Pokémon mobile game, which point to a Dec. 8 launch date.
Based on the leaked images, which come from a webpage purportedly accessible by Starbucks employees, a large number of stores will become PokéStops or gyms as part of the event. Players who swing by their nearest participating Starbucks can pick up a unique item: the Pokémon Go Frappuccino Blended Beverage.
Starbucks will reportedly sell an actual version of the drink during the event’s duration. The Pokémon Go Frappuccino is vanilla bean-flavored with raspberry syrup, freeze-dried blackberries and whipped cream, according to Starbucks.

Beyond the special drink offer, however, the employee details suggest that there’s a bigger update involved.
“The world of Pokémon Go is about to expand with new Pokémon,” the printout reads. Users datamined the game earlier this fall and found code for 100 new species of Pokémon already baked in — the entire second generation of monsters. Following the leaks surfacing, Niantic revealed that more Pokémon will soon come to the game; more information is due Dec. 12.
Niantic, developer of the free-to-play smash hit, announced over the summer that it had plans to collaborate with corporate sponsors, much as it did with Ingress. In the developer’s earlier, location-based mobile game, these promotions involved turning real world retailers into places of note for players.
In Japan, McDonald’s worked with Niantic to transform some of its locations into PokéStops.
Update: Starbucks and Niantic have confirmed the collaboration, which begins at 11 a.m. PT on Dec. 8. Along with transforming 7,800 Starbucks locations into gyms and PokéStops, a special Frappuccino will be sold “for a limited time” in honor of the game.
